Booker Taps Lynch as D.C.-based Press Secretary

U.S. Sen. Cory Booker (D-NJ) today announced that Kristin Lynch will join his office as Press Secretary, effective today. Lynch, who will be based in Booker’s Washington, DC, office, joins Communications Director Jeff Giertz and New Jersey Press Secretary Tom Pietrykoski on the press team.

“We’re excited to have Kristin come on board,” Booker said. “Her skills, experience, and passion for public service make her a tremendous addition to our team. I look forward to working with her to help New Jerseyans every day.”

A graduate of Princeton University, Lynch most recently worked as Colorado Communications Director for Hillary for America. Lynch has also served as Rep. Jared Polis’ (D-CO) communications director, press secretary on Sen. Mark Udall’s (D-CO) re-election campaign, and state press secretary to Sen. Michael Bennet (D-CO).  Lynch began her career as a reporter with the Phnom Penh Post in Phnom Penh, Cambodia.
